In today's Office of Readings we encounter a reading from the treatise of St John Eudes (1601-1680) on the kingdom of Jesus. St John Eudes was born and died in Normandy. He was ordained priest and spent many years preaching parish missions. He organized a congregation of nuns that grew into the Sisters of Our Lady of Charity, dedicated to the care of women rescued from a disorderly life, and a congregation of priests dedicated to the running of seminaries. He was active in encouraging devotion to the Sacred Heart, and to the Immaculate Heart of Mary. For a reflection, "The mystery of Christ in us and in the Church," please click on the image.
